## GridForge: Stuck Generation Queue

If the crossword generator stops emitting puzzles, check the solver pool first. GridForge caps each grid attempt at 90 seconds; when attempts pile up, the queue backs up silently. Restart the solver workers with the standard drain command, then confirm new grids appear within five minutes. Do not clear the word-list cache unless instructed by the puzzles team. Full escalation steps and dashboards are documented on the internal page below.

operations page: https://kibana.sivrelcloud.corp/browse/spaces/spaces/issue/16dd39fa3e3f990c

# Catalog cache invalidation client setup.
#
# The Shelfwright catalog service pushes invalidation events whenever a
# product record changes. This client subscribes to that stream and purges
# matching entries from the local edge cache. Note: events are at-least-once,
# so purges must be idempotent — don't assume a key exists before deleting.
# Reconnects use exponential backoff, capped at 60s. The client authenticates
# to the invalidation stream with a service key, which is:

service key, yadug-bajog: zpat3_pou

For the incoming director: marketing spend will be reduced by 22% next quarter, concentrated in paid media and event sponsorships. Brand and lifecycle programmes are protected. The Ashgrove campaign proceeds at reduced scale; the Pellmore launch is deferred one quarter. Agency contracts are being renegotiated to month-to-month terms. Teams have been briefed on priorities, and the reduced plan still meets the pipeline targets agreed with sales. The rationale behind the cut is set out in the note below.

management briefing: Project Ulavan slips by two quarters because of the staffing delay.

Rotated the signing key for the Consentra banner rollout pipeline following our standard quarterly schedule. No incident prompted this rotation. The previous key was revoked in the Quillhaven trust store and all banner bundles built after this release are signed with the replacement. Maintainers should ensure any cached verification material is refreshed before validating new consent bundle artifacts. Older bundles remain verifiable against the archived key record. The new signing key active as of this release is recorded below.

release key, hagug-yaguf: bky13_NnhXrmFGhCRtW